What the course is about

<p>An informal and fun short course where you will have a go at using your device through a variety of activities with a Tutor available to support you. The focus is on having fun, exploring new techniques and just having a go.</p>

<p>Activities will be varied but may include:</p>

<ul>
<li>Introduction to tablets and smartphones. The difference between a smart phone and tablet.</li>
<li>How to interact with and use a touch screen device. </li>
<li>Charging, turning on/off, putting to sleep/waking and initial setup for the first time. </li>
<li>Adding, removing, grouping icons into folders. </li>
<li>Changing your ‘settings’ and dealing with notifications.</li>
<li>Using the camera to take pictures and movies and how to share them with friends and family. 10. How to use email on an Android tablet. </li>
